Steve; Did you know that the Tomb of The Unknown Soldier is one solid block of White Marble which was mined by the Yule Marble Co at Marble Colorado back in the 1930's? The quarry and a lot of the Mine and Milling operations still remain there.That is not too far from you. Take a trip to Glenwood Springs,then south out of town to Carbondale ,take a right to Redstone and a little farther right before you continue towards McClure pass take a left to Marble. A favorite tourist spot for us,or go to Paonia and go over McClure pass and at the foot of the grade down from the pass take a right to Marble.We have camped along the roaring fork at Crystal.
